When I first encountered Bitcoin, a nearly insatiable curiosity took over, which I later heard people refer to as "falling down the rabbit hole."

Almost immediately, I wanted to know as much as I could about how all the various parts and pieces of Bitcoin worked.

One fun tool for me was a simple demo of how a blockchain works, put together by Anders Brownworth.

I had never heard of a blockchain prior to 2021. But his short videos made the concept of a blockchain easy to understand and got me up to speed very quickly. His cleanly designed site allows allowed me to play with a demo chain.

You can find his site, "Blockchain Demo" here:
